64096036 has 9 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 112196091. Its totient is φ = 32040012.
The previous prime is 64096013. The next prime is 64096111. The reversal of 64096036 is 63069046.
The square root of 64096036 is 8006.
It is a perfect power (a square), and thus also a powerful number.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 64095992 and 64096010.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(11)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 2 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 14011 + ... + 18013.
Almost surely, 264096036 is an apocalyptic number.
64096036 is the 8006-th square number.
It is an amenable number.
64096036 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(48100055).
64096036 is an frugal number, since it uses more digits than its factorization.
64096036 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 8010 (or 4005 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 23328, while the sum is 34.
